Passive voice is also effective in sentences where the identity of who is performing the action is unknown obvious or unimportant. The use of passive voice is most seen in scientific journals scientific papers etc since the subject is not necessary does not add to the following process. The passive voice places greater importance on the person or thing that is experiencing an action rather than the person or thing that is performing the action.

When we dont know who performed the action we tend to use the passive voice because it allows us to omit the subject.
